Transaction 8d323cc51852aa43b1eefbd2667beb72813cfdab34d574f31230798848b5dfd2
1 Input
1 Output
-
8d323cc51852aa43b1eefbd2667beb72813cfdab34d574f31230798848b5dfd2:0
- value
- 62980463
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 240423cf377473a159ce951bfaf3f8cc5d40ab92abd27d89cbd4bb6da83f2380
- address
- bc1pyszz8nehw3e6zkwwj5dl4ulce3w5p2uj40f8mzwt6jakm2plywqq6a8usr